The Big River, now called Fraser; grey, fast, deep.

Charted but wild. The entire land locked

by mountains, ocean and artificial line called

border – yet, there too, right on the other side of

that invisible line, lies another wall:

the Cascades. Between these two walls is She, staľәẁ.

The vein carrying the lifeline of the Valley.

Called today a Fraser Valley. Living river,

like a huge Snake of Life, of good and bad.

staľәẁ the Lifegiver, and staľәẁ the Lifetaker.

/B. Pacak-Gamalski, 07.2025/
